How much do civil eng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 3, 2026, the average yearly pay for civil engineer in Edmonton, AB is $82,396.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$67,500.00 and $92,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What do civil engineers do?

Civil engineers design, build, supervise, operate, and maintain infrastructure projects and systems such as roads, bridges, airports, tunnels, dams, and water supply systems. They work in both the public and private sectors, ensuring that structures are safe, efficient, and environmentally sustainable. Civil engineers also assess environmental impact, manage construction projects, and ensure compliance with regulations and codes.

What is the difference between Civil Engineer vs Structural Engineer?

AspectCivil EngineerStructural Engineer
CredentialsBachelor's in Civil Engineering, PE license often requiredBachelor's in Civil or Structural Engineering, PE license often required
Work EnvironmentConstruction sites, design offices, urban planningDesign offices, construction sites, specialized structural analysis
Industry UsageBroadly involved in infrastructure, transportation, water resourcesFocused on structural integrity of buildings, bridges, towers
Common Search/ComparisonYesYes

While both Civil Engineers and Structural Engineers hold similar credentials and often work in overlapping environments, Civil Engineers have a broader scope, handling various infrastructure projects. Structural Engineers specialize in analyzing and designing structural components to ensure safety and stability. Understanding these differences helps in choosing the right career path or consulting the appropriate professional for your project needs.

Job Description

We are seeking a Civil Engineering Technologist to join our land development and civil infrastructure team in Edmonton, Alberta.

In this role, you will prepare engineering and construction drawings, develop AutoCAD Civil 3D models, and support multidisciplinary project teams across road design, grading and drainage, stormwater management, municipal servicing, subdivision design, highway corridors, LRT, and BRT projects.

This opportunity is ideal for a detail-oriented Civil Engineering Technologist with 1–3 years of experience in civil infrastructure design who wants to grow within a leading infrastructure consulting firm and contribute to major projects across Canada.

Key Responsibilities

  • Prepare engineering and construction drawings for land development, subdivision design, municipal servicing, highway corridors, LRT, and BRT projects.
  • Develop plans, profiles, surfaces, pipe networks, pressure pipe networks, grading models, and corridor designs using AutoCAD Civil 3D.
  • Support road design, stormwater management, drainage design, and municipal infrastructure design workflows.
  • Interpret and apply municipal, provincial, and client design standards, including Alberta regulatory requirements.
  • Collaborate with engineers, designers, technologists, and multidisciplinary project teams across Edmonton, Alberta, and Western Canada.
  • Conduct field visits and site inspections as required to support design development and project delivery.
  • Stay current with evolving CAD, Civil 3D, BIM, and digital delivery technologies.
  • Support continuous improvement by adopting tools and workflows that improve drawing quality, model accuracy, and project efficiency.
Qualifications
  • College diploma in Civil Engineering Technology, Engineering Design and Drafting Technology, Geomatics Engineering Technology, or equivalent — NAIT, SAIT, or BCIT graduates preferred.
  • Registered or eligible for registration with ASET as a Certified Engineering Technologist (C.E.T.) or Technologist in Training (T.T.).
  • 1–3 years of experience in civil infrastructure design, land development, municipal servicing, or subdivision design.
  • Proficiency in AutoCAD and AutoCAD Civil 3D.
  • Familiarity with Autodesk Forma, Autodesk Construction Cloud (ACC), or BIM 360 is an asset
  • Familiarity with Alberta municipal standards and provincial design requirements is an asset.
  • Strong attention to detail, analytical thinking, and problem-solving skills.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ills in English.
  • Valid driver’s license with access to a vehicle.
